The Anti- Corruption Court has adjourned the case in which the Interdicted Principal Accountant in the Office of the Prime Minister, Mr Godfrey Kazinda is facing charges of forgery to April 3.

Justice David Wangutusi adjourned the case in because he had to attend a requiem service for Justice Constance Byamugisha, who died on Thursday, at All Saints Cathedral, Kampala.

Mr Kazinda is accused of forging the signature of the OPM Permanent Secretary to illegally withdraw money from government accounts.

He faces 29 charges of abuse of office, forgery and unlawful possession of government stores.
